- Home
> - Oklahoma
> - Tulsa
BMW Of Tulsa's Location On Map
9702 S MEMORIAL DR,
Tulsa, OK - 74133
866-879-8074
We can you Detailed route from your location to BMW Of Tulsa 9702 S MEMORIAL DR Tulsa Oklahoma 74133 on google maps with traffic summary on map.